Basics
Node.js Console
Using the Console
Node.js console logs messages with methods like info and error.
Overview of the Node.js Console
The Node.js console is a global object used for printing messages to the standard output and standard error streams. It is similar to the JavaScript console object found in browsers and provides several methods to log messages, including console.info
and console.error
. This post will guide you through using these methods effectively.
Basic Logging with console.log
The most common method for logging in Node.js is console.log()
. It outputs messages to the standard output. This method can be used to print both strings and variables.
Logging Informational Messages with console.info
The console.info()
method is functionally similar to console.log()
but is intended for informational messages. It can be used when you want to distinguish between regular output and informational content.
Handling Errors with console.error
The console.error()
method outputs messages to the standard error stream. It is typically used for logging error messages or warnings. This method can help separate error logs from regular logs, especially when redirecting output streams.
Advanced Console Methods
In addition to the basic logging methods, the Node.js console object provides other useful methods such as console.warn()
, console.dir()
, and console.time()
. These methods offer more control and flexibility over logging operations.
Conclusion
The Node.js console is a powerful tool for logging messages and debugging applications. By using methods like console.log()
, console.info()
, and console.error()
, developers can efficiently monitor and troubleshoot their applications. Exploring advanced methods further enhances logging capabilities, making Node.js a versatile platform for building robust applications.
Basics
- Previous
- Global Objects
- Next
- Process